DESCRIPTION
The LH1556 dual 1 form A relays are SPST normally open
switches that can replace electromechanical relays in many
applications. They are constructed using a GaAIAs LED for
actuation control and an integrated monolithic die for the
switch output. The die, fabricated in a high-voltage
dielectrically isolated technology is comprised of a
photodiode array, switch control circuitry, and MOSFET
switches. In addition, the LH1556 SSRs employ
current-limiting circuitry, enabling them to pass lightning
surge testing as per ANSI/TIA-968-B and other regulatory
surge requirements when overvoltage protection is
provided.

Notes
• Stresses in excess of the absolute maximum ratings can cause permanent damage to the device. Functional operation of the device is not
implied at these or any other conditions in excess of those given in the operational sections of this document. Exposure to absolute
maximum ratings for extended periods of the time can adversely affect reliability.
(1)
Refer to current limit performance application note for a discussion on relay operation during transient currents.
